UAE Welcomes Ceasefire between Iran and Israel

The United Arab Emirates welcomed the announcement of reaching an agreement to cease fire between the Islamic Republic of Iran and the State of Israel, expressing hope that this development will be a step towards de-escalation and creating a supportive environment for regional stability.
This came in a statement by the UAE Ministry of Foreign Affairs, appreciating the diplomatic efforts made by His Excellency Donald Trump, President of the friendly United States of America, and the constructive role played by His Highness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ani, Emir of the sisterly State of Qatar, in facilitating reaching this agreement. The statement emphasized the importance of continued effective coordination to prevent further escalation and avoid its humanitarian and security repercussions in the region.
The United Arab Emirates also reaffirmed its consistent position calling for the necessity of self-restraint, prioritizing political solutions and dialogue, and avoiding further conflicts in the region that hinder development opportunities and threaten the security of its peoples.
The country renewed its commitment to work with its regional and international partners to establish the foundations of peace, enhance security, stability, and development in the region and the world.
